Safeguard Your Investment: Facial Sunscreen for Every Day
Your skin is your primary organ and a valuable investment. Just like you care your car or other prized possessions, it's crucial to safeguard your skin from the damaging effects of the sun's ultraviolet (UV) rays. Daily use of facial sunscreen is an essential practice in maintaining your skin's health and beauty.
A potent SPF of at least 30 absorbs harmful UVA and UVB rays, preventing premature aging, irritation, and even reducing the risk of skin cancer. Choose a sunscreen that is specifically formulated for facial skin, as it tends to be more fragile than other areas of your body.
Look for ingredients like zinc oxide or titanium dioxide, which offer broad-spectrum protection. Apply sunscreen generously to all exposed skin surfaces at least 15 minutes before going out yourself to the sun and reapply every two hours, especially after swimming or sweating.
